Transaction 570bdf514ad7ea7d99dc039e7b292b8d91a7da79cd56e3457b4ea35deb8f382e

3 Input
1 Outputs
  • 570bdf514ad7ea7d99dc039e7b292b8d91a7da79cd56e3457b4ea35deb8f382e:0
  • value  124088
    address  356QRzFp3sMUU3Jr1rsMaZ83UvQ7iSSxTW